Runcorn - An Industrial Town Along The Manchester Ship Canal


Runcorn is one of our ports along the Manchester Ship Canal.  It's a small town with a little bit of everything... shops, bar, takeaways and a park with a nice view of the famous Runcorn's Silver Jubilee Bridge, which crosses the river Mersey.



The church at my back is the All Saints Parish Church, an Angelican church located at the center of the town.  As most of the people living in Runcorn declare themeselves as Christian, there are a dozen other churches in the town.
